Two favorite summertime drinks combined into one.

Servings 8 servings
Calories 302
Author Annalise Sandberg
- 750 ml bottle dry white wine , like a sauvignon blanc or chardonnay
- 1 ½ cup tequila (375 ml)
- 1 cup triple sec (250 ml)
- 1 cup freshly squeezed orange juice (250 ml)
- 1/2 cup freshly squeezed lime juice (125 ml)
- 1 orange , sliced
- 2 limes , sliced
- A few stems of cilantro , see Note
- Coarse salt , for glass rims
- Crushed ice , for serving
In a large pitcher combine the white wine, tequila, triple sec, orange juice and lime juice. Add the orange slices and lime slices, and the cilantro.
Chill for at least 2 hours. Serve over ice. Salt the rims of the glasses, if desired.
NOTES:
- The longer the sangria sits with the cilantro, the stronger the flavor will be. You can also add the cilantro right before serving.
